The new metal analyser will enable the more than 400 members of the Group to instantly check the purity of gold and other metals.
The German-manufactured 'GoldCheck' is the latest in X-ray fluorescence instrumentation and can determine the precise percentage by weight (of karat) in a solid piece of jewellery in just minutes. The new analyser will enable retailers and wholesalers to check the purity of gold and other precious metals.
Speaking about the GoldCheck, Mr Tawhid Abdullah, Chairman of the Gold and Jewellery Group, said, 'This will be a great benefit to our members, as it would be extremely difficult for any of them to individually invest in such a sophisticated system. There is already a very high level of purity in Dubai, but this analyser will give security of mind to those dealing in gold. It will also help to increase consumer confidence in gold and other precious metals.'
He added that the Group is also planning to extend availability of the GoldCheck to consumers, who will be able to check the gold for free. This will reassure shoppers about the purity of the gold they are buying.
'This move fulfils two objectives of the Gold and Jewellery Group. We aim to promote the gold trade in Dubai, and we also want to provide valuable services to our members.'

Gold & Jewellery Group to install gold analyser to guarantee purity
The Gold and Jewellery Group will install a gold alloys and precious metal analyser in Gold Land in Deira's Gold Souk this month.

An association of more than 400 gold and jewellery outlets in Dubai, the Gold and Jewellery Group is responsible for promoting and improving the gold and jewellery trade in Dubai.Founded in 1995, the group has participated in Dubai Shopping Festival as one of the Key Sponsors since its inception, and has rolled out many innovative promotions. It also organises extensive training programmes for members to help them improve services to consumers. Its activities have played a key role in helping Dubai gain the title of 'City of Gold'.
